When updating dom0 (sudo qubes-dom0-update) I keep getting:

error: could not delete old database at 
/var/lib/qubes/dom0-updates/home/user/.rpmdbold.2380

It doesn't seem like this is causing an issue but I would like to delete the 
old database.  I think I found a solution but I wanted to make sure its sound 
before i try it.  Feedback would be appreciated.

> https://unix.stackexchange.com/questions/395468/yum-and-rpm-error-rpmdbnextiterator-skipping-h#464986
>
> $ sudo rpmdb --rebuilddb -v
> error: could not delete old database at /var/lib/rpmold.17138
>
> $ sudo rm -rf /var/lib/rpmold.17138
>
> $ sudo rpmdb --rebuilddb -v
>
> $ sudo dnf update --refresh
